Technical field
The utility model relates to a kind of reactor, and particularly a kind of highly effective reaction still, belongs to reaction vessel technical field.
Background technology
Reactor is a kind of consersion unit that chemical plant is commonly used now, and it mainly carrys out reaction stirred by motor drive shaft makes it fully react to obtain required material.Along with constantly sending out of chemical field, people to chemical products manufacture a finished product and the precision of chemical products all improves higher requirement, corresponding people it is also proposed higher requirement to the visual plant reactor in chemical reaction; In the process of Chemical Manufacture, the hybrid reaction of some material will complete within the extremely short time, this just requires the material that mixed once is less, or use high-power reactor to mix rapidly, even if also have mixing to be difficult to uniform phenomenon like this, reactant is produced after reaction, some generation precipitations, the time goes down for a long time, will work in reactor body.Cause affecting product quality and production effect, functional reliability is low.

Detailed description of the invention
Below in conjunction with accompanying drawing, preferred embodiment of the present utility model is described, should be appreciated that preferred embodiment described herein is only for instruction and explanation of the utility model, and be not used in restriction the utility model.
Embodiment: as shown in Figure 1-2, a kind of highly effective reaction still of the utility model, reaction kettle cover 1, reactor body 7, stirring motor 4, and be arranged on the gas control valve 3 at reaction kettle cover 1 top and be arranged on the discharging opening 13 of side bottom reactor body 7, reaction kettle cover 1 top arranges stirring motor frame 2 and gas control valve 3, stirring motor 4 is set above stirring motor frame 2, stirring motor arranges shaft coupling 54 times, connecting shaft 6 below shaft coupling 5 imports in reactor body 7, arrange in the middle part of shaft 6 and stir horizontal blade 8, shaft 6 bottom is arranged stirs turning arm 9, stir turning arm 9 to be connected with shaft 6 by connector 10, stirring turning arm 9 arranges some stirrings and erects blade 11, reactor originally covers 1 side and arranges charging aperture 12, reactor body 7 bottom sides arranges discharging opening 13 and several fixed mounts 14.
Stir horizontal blade 8 be 2 and be symmetricly set on shaft 6, stirring turning arm 9 is 2, and be symmetricly set on shaft 6 bottom, stir perpendicular blade 11 be 6 and, evenly be arranged on and stir on turning arm 9, make shaft 6 in the process stirred, reach stable equilibrium, make to stir in reactor body 7, fully react.
Shaft coupling 5 is with shaft 6 for spiral is connected, and shaft 6 passes through connector 10 with stirring turning arm 9 for spiral is connected, easy disassembly, for ease of maintenaince.
Fixed mount 14 is 2 and is arranged on reactor body 7 side, reaches stable equilibrium, makes in the process of rotating at stirring motor, by reactor body 7 stable equilibrium.
Mounting means and concrete principle, a kind of highly effective reaction still, reaction kettle cover 1, reactor body 7, stirring motor 4, and be arranged on the gas control valve 3 at reaction kettle cover 1 top and be arranged on the discharging opening 13 of side bottom reactor body 7, reaction kettle cover 1 top arranges stirring motor frame 2 and gas control valve 3, stirring motor 4 is set above stirring motor frame 2, stirring motor arranges shaft coupling 54 times, connecting shaft 6 below shaft coupling 5 imports in reactor body 7, arrange in the middle part of shaft 6 and stir horizontal blade 8, shaft 6 bottom is arranged stirs turning arm 9, stir turning arm 9 to be connected with shaft 6 by connector 10, stirring turning arm 9 arranges some stirrings and erects blade 11, reactor originally covers 1 side and arranges charging aperture 12, reactor body 7 bottom sides arranges discharging opening 13 and several fixed mounts 14.
During use, material is entered in reactor body 7 by charging aperture 12, stirring motor 4 makes shaft 6 rotate, drive and stir horizontal blade 8 and stir perpendicular blade 11, make material stirring even, material is fully reacted, decides to react rear generation gas by gas control valve and whether get rid of, material will be made to enter accumulator tank by discharging opening 13 after reaction and store.
